The principle employed in the operation of an artificial kidney is hemodialysis, which involves filtering waste products and excess fluids from the blood using a semipermeable membrane. The machine works by circulating blood from the patient through the filter to remove toxins and electrolytes before returning the filtered blood back to the body. This helps to mimic the role of a functioning kidney in maintaining the balance of fluids and chemicals in the body.

Dialysis is a procedure by which waste products which would normally be removed by the kidneys are removed by diffusions across a semipermeable membrane. This procedure is done when the kidneys have failed, or when a dangerous toxin is present in the blood and needs to be removed quickly.There are two kinds of dialysis for renal failure: hemodialysis, where the blood is filtered through a machine; and peritoneal dialysis, where the abdominal peritoneal lining is used as the semipermeable membrane across which the toxins are filtered.Each of these methods has benefits and drawbacks.
